Portfolio management and reporting systems serve as the operational backbone for RIAs, directly impacting client experience, operational efficiency, and business growth. These platforms handle critical daily functions. The choice of vendor significantly affects staff productivity, error rates, client satisfaction, and the firm’s ability to scale. The wrong choice can create operational bottlenecks, increase compliance risks, and limit growth potential.

This report evaluates the overall competitive position of six vendors, focusing on vendor stability, client strength, product features, and client services. This report profiles Addepar, Advyzon, Orion, Bank of New York Pershing (Wove), SEI, and SS&C (Black Diamond).
